All Duke is is the DooM engine with Mlook, jump, and crouch???

What's wrong with you? They're two separate engines that were in fact in development at the same time, Duke being started a few years and released a few years later. Internally the game engines are quite different from each other. Textures are aligned differently along walls. Transparant texturing could be used. Floors could be SLANTED. More than one type of door could be used. Colored lighting. It had rudementary 3 dimensional capabilites, such as one object being over another object including room over room. You could actually go underwater and swim, which Quake tried to do but neglected animations for it. Duke introduced interactivity into the genre, such as blowing a wall open with a well placed rocket. The build engine had a lot more going for it than just Mlook, jump, and crouch junior.
